FAQ

Cargo questions from The Woodlands clients.

What limit do shippers usually require?

$100K is standard for general freight; reefer, electronics, and high-value goods often require $250K or more. Some contracts write specific commodity limits — we match your book.

Is broker's contingent cargo the same as motor truck cargo?

No. Contingent cargo protects the broker when a contracted carrier's cargo policy fails to respond. Motor truck cargo is the carrier's own primary policy.
